Q3: What does VVS1-2 clarity mean for a diamond?

A: VVS1-2 refers to the clarity grade of the diamond, standing for “Very, Very Slightly Included.” This means that any inclusions (internal characteristics) or blemishes (external characteristics) are extremely difficult to see under 10x magnification, even for a skilled grader.

VVS1 diamonds have inclusions that are exceptionally difficult to spot, while VVS2 inclusions are only very difficult to see. For practical purposes, diamonds in this clarity range are considered eye-clean, meaning no imperfections are visible to the naked eye, ensuring exceptional brilliance.

Q4: What does E-F color mean for this Marquise Lab Diamond Ring?

A: The E-F color grade places this diamond in the “near colorless” category. The diamond will appear bright white with no noticeable yellow or brown tints to the naked eye. The color scale ranges from D (colorless) to Z (light yellow or brown).

E and F are premium grades, indicating that the diamond possesses very little to no color, allowing its natural fire and brilliance to be fully appreciated without any distracting hues. This is a highly sought-after color range for engagement rings.

Q6: What’s the difference between 10K, 14K, and 18K solid gold?

A: The karat number indicates the purity of the gold in the metal alloy. 24K is pure gold. 18K gold is 75% pure gold (18 parts gold, 6 parts other metals), 14K gold is 58.3% pure gold (14 parts gold, 10 parts other metals), and 10K gold is 41.7% pure gold (10 parts gold, 14 parts other metals).

18K is the purest and typically has a richer gold color, but it’s softer. 10K is the most durable due to its higher alloy content, making it more resistant to scratches and dents, though its gold color is slightly less intense. 14K offers a good balance of purity, durability, and cost.

Q7: How should I care for my Marquise Lab Diamond Ring?

A: To maintain the brilliance of your Marquise Lab Diamond Ring, regular cleaning is recommended. You can clean it at home using a soft toothbrush, mild dish soap, and warm water. Gently scrub the diamond and setting, then rinse thoroughly and pat dry with a lint-free cloth.

Avoid exposing your ring to harsh chemicals like bleach or chlorine, and remove it during strenuous activities to prevent damage. Professional cleaning and inspection by a jeweler every 6-12 months can also help maintain its beauty and ensure the setting is secure.

Q8: Can lab-grown diamonds pass a diamond tester?

A: Yes, absolutely. Lab-grown diamonds are real diamonds, possessing the same thermal and electrical conductivity as natural diamonds. Therefore, they will pass any standard diamond tester designed to distinguish diamonds from simulants like cubic zirconia.

A diamond tester primarily measures thermal conductivity, and since lab-grown diamonds have the same thermal properties as natural diamonds, they will register as genuine diamonds on these devices. This is a key differentiator from non-diamond substitutes.
